#c52494 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c52494 is composed of 77.3% red, 14.1%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.7% magenta, 24.9%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 318.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 45.7%. #c52494 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ff48ff with #8b0029.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#c52494 color description : Strong pink.
The hexadecimal color #c52494 has RGB values of R:197, G:36,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.25,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12919956.
